当前位置:首页 / EXCEL

Excel表格如何斜分?如何设置单元格斜线?

作者:佚名|分类:EXCEL|浏览:91|发布时间:2025-04-17 11:31:50

Excel表格如何斜分?如何设置单元格斜线?

在Excel中,斜分单元格或设置单元格斜线是一种常见的操作,可以用来突出显示某些数据或美化表格。以下是如何在Excel中实现单元格斜分的详细步骤:

1. 使用斜线工具

Excel提供了一个斜线工具,可以直接使用它来创建斜线。

打开Excel,选择需要添加斜线的单元格。

在“开始”选项卡中,找到“字体”组。

点击“字体”组右下角的箭头,打开“字体”对话框。

在“字体”对话框中,切换到“特殊效果”选项卡。

在“特殊效果”选项卡中,勾选“斜线”复选框。

选择你想要的斜线样式(水平、垂直或对角线),然后点击“确定”。

2. 使用斜线键

如果你不想使用“字体”对话框,也可以通过快捷键来设置单元格斜线。

选择需要添加斜线的单元格。

按下`Ctrl + Shift + -`(减号键)来添加斜线。

如果需要调整斜线的样式,可以重复使用这个快捷键。

3. 使用公式

如果你想要在单元格中显示斜线,但又不希望斜线影响数据的显示,可以使用公式来实现。

在需要显示斜线的单元格中输入以下公式:`=IF(1=1,"数据","")`。

这里的“数据”是你想要显示的内容。

公式中的`IF`函数确保了即使单元格为空,也不会显示斜线。

4. 使用条件格式

条件格式也可以用来在单元格中添加斜线。

选择包含数据的单元格区域。

在“开始”选项卡中,点击“条件格式”。

选择“新建规则”。

在弹出的对话框中,选择“使用公式确定要设置的格式”。

在“格式值等于以下公式时”输入框中输入公式:`=TRUE`。

点击“格式”按钮,选择“边框”选项卡。

在“边框”选项卡中,选择你想要的斜线样式,然后点击“确定”。

最后,点击“确定”完成条件格式的设置。

5. 使用VBA宏

如果你需要频繁地在Excel中设置单元格斜线,可以使用VBA宏来简化操作。

打开Excel,按下`Alt + F11`打开VBA编辑器。

在VBA编辑器中,插入一个新的模块。

在模块中输入以下代码:

```vba

Sub SetCellDiagonalLine()

Dim cell As Range

For Each cell In Selection

With cell

.Borders.LineStyle = xlSolid

.Borders.ColorIndex = 1

.Borders.Weight = xlMedium

.Borders.Diagonal = xlDiagonalUp

End With

Next cell

End Sub

```

返回Excel,按下`Alt + F8`,选择`SetCellDiagonalLine`宏,然后运行。

相关问答

1. 如何删除单元格中的斜线?

选择包含斜线的单元格。

在“开始”选项卡中,找到“字体”组。

点击“字体”组右下角的箭头,打开“字体”对话框。

在“字体”对话框中,取消勾选“斜线”复选框。

点击“确定”。

2. 斜线会影响单元格的数据输入吗?

不,斜线只是单元格的格式设置,不会影响数据的输入。

3. 如何设置单元格中的斜线方向?

在“字体”对话框的“特殊效果”选项卡中,你可以选择不同的斜线方向,如水平、垂直或对角线。

4. 我可以使用斜线来突出显示特定数据吗?

是的,你可以使用条件格式来根据特定条件自动添加斜线,从而突出显示特定数据。

5. 如何在VBA宏中设置单元格的斜线?

在VBA代码中,你可以使用`With`语句和`Borders`属性来设置单元格的斜线。如上面的示例代码所示。


参考内容:https://qianziwen.yqkyqc.cn/